The YAMAHA DM 1000 is used in a variety of applications such as multi-track recording, 2-channel mixing and high-quality surround sound production. It has touch-sensitive motorized faders which set the levels for the input channels, auxiliary sends and bus outs. It also has encoders that control panning for the channels, auxiliary send levels and other parameters of the system.

Based on physiographic, the land of Kerala can be classified into highland, midland and coastal region. This classification is based on the altitude from the mean sea level. The sandy region 8 miles from the sea level is known as the coastal region. The portion of the land between 8 miles to 75 miles is known as midland.
